Output 620325dcac968ab1eea1b6d4ed0b2efbd194cf8e268ea440a81ae3c79f8d2480:0

value
2398960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a88a138b5b03338985479b2f47fd8e302d61eeb0 OP_EQUALVERIFY OP_CHECKSIG
address
1GN9vwXhZtnAgFN3VKXvPpuo57MrbDexgj
transaction
620325dcac968ab1eea1b6d4ed0b2efbd194cf8e268ea440a81ae3c79f8d2480
confirmations
375441
spent
true